What Are Disability Ramps?
Disability ramps, likewise referred to as wheelchair ramps, tend surface areas designed to assist individuals with mobility difficulties in accessing elevated surfaces, such as buildings, pathways, and automobiles. They are vital elements of universal style-- a principle that promotes accessibility for individuals of all capabilities.

Laws and Standards
When setting up disability ramps, sticking to specific regulations and standards is vital. In the United States, the Americans with Disabilities Act (ADA) offers standards governing ramp building and construction. Below are some of the essential technical specs:
SpecificationRequirementSlope ratioMinimum 1:12 (rise to run)WidthMinimum of 36 inchesSurfaceNon-slip, firm surfaceHeightMaximum increase of 30 inches without landingsHandrailsNeeded for ramps over 6 inches rise
These specs make sure that ramps are safe and practical for their designated users. Regional structure codes should likewise be spoken with, as they might have additional requirements.
Setup Considerations
Installing a disability ramp includes mindful planning and execution. Here are a number of aspects to take into consideration throughout the procedure:

Site Evaluation: Assess the area where the ramp will be installed. Consider the existing surface and any barriers that may impact accessibility.

Licenses and Compliance: Determine if local guidelines need permits for ramp installation. Be sure to comply with developing codes and ADA standards.

Material Selection: Select proper products that are long lasting and capable of standing up to weather. Common materials include wood, aluminum, concrete, and fiberglass.

Style Features: Ensure the ramp integrates style functions such as hand rails, landings for rest, and surface area textures to avoid slips and falls.

Maintenance: Schedule regular inspections and maintenance to ensure ramps remain safe and functional in time. Address concerns such as wear and tear, surface area damage, or obstructions.
Frequently Asked Question About Disability Ramps
1. How steep can a disability ramp be?The ADA
advises an optimum slope of 1:12 for wheelchairs, implying for every single inch of height, there need to be at least 12 inches of horizontal run.

2. Are ramps needed in private homes?While not lawfully required for private homes, setting up ramps can considerably boost availability for member of the family or visitors with disabilities. 3. Can ramps be made to fit any space?Yes, ramps can be custom-made or modular to fit a variety of areas, taking into consideration height, width, and website conditions. 4. What are threshold ramps?Threshold ramps serve as a bridge over small height differences, such as door limits
, to create a barrier-free transition. 5. Exist grants available for setting up disability ramps?Various companies and federal government companies might provide financing or grants to help with availability adjustments, consisting of ramp setup.
